Transaction 546711fabc76852fce29b87b4a61d186e2386ee922bbcbf24bd25ee5e5ee6dac

1 Input
2 Outputs
  • 546711fabc76852fce29b87b4a61d186e2386ee922bbcbf24bd25ee5e5ee6dac:0
  • value  34801458
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 546711fabc76852fce29b87b4a61d186e2386ee922bbcbf24bd25ee5e5ee6dac:1
  • value  2629718
    address  3KRDy56EaXSfuaHU5duMewA1CN3Kd65ocp